Now that National Science Week is over, we’re excited to be able to congratulate Associate Investigator Lachlan Rogers and his team—author and science communicator Lee Constable (team captain) and astrophysicist Kirsten Banks—on winning the 2024 National Science Quiz!

This year’s quiz was led by CSIRO and hosted by ABC News Breakfast Weather Presenter, Meteorologist and Science Communicator Nate Byrne.  The competitors were science communicator Rachel Raynor (team captain), entomologist and author Bryan Lessard and Indigital Founder and CEO Mikaela Jade.

The teams battled it out over 4 rounds of questions, including true/flase, multi-choice, closest-to and open-ended questions, including a guest sponsor question from EQUS Deputy Director John Bartholomew.

Viewers were also able to play along, via Kahoot, with top individuals, teams and schools winning prizes.
